Due Diligence refers to the process of investigating a person, company or investment opportunity prior to entering into a formal relationship. Due Diligence involves a combination of background checks, formal interviews with one or more key persons and it also includes a review of that person’s or company’s business methods and operations. The objective of Due Diligence is to confirm that what has been presented as truth in fact is the truth.

For insurance agents, Due Diligence includes staying on top of their appointed companies and their changing financial condition. It should also include a proper review of key information about the various brokers through which the agent places policies and sends premium on behalf of his clients.

For investors, proper Due Diligence should uncover questionable issues about the investment promoter or the veracity of his investment track record. In addition, investment promoters should be prepared to accept a reasonable amount of accountability through language in their Offering Memorandums and Operating Agreements that allows their investors reasonable access to books and records. Independent administrators and auditors should be part of the investment structure and those persons should be interviewed as well.
